STATE v. SELMAN

No. 90517.

2008 Ohio 4582

State of Ohio, Plaintiff-Appellee, v. Richard Selman, Defendant-Appellant.

Court of Appeals of Ohio, Eighth District, Cuyahoga County.

Released: September 11, 2008.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Edwin J. Vargas, Summers & Vargas Co., LPA, 2000 Illuminating Building, 55 Public Square, Cleveland, OH 44113, Attorney for Appellant.

William D. Mason, Cuyahoga County Prosecutor, BY: Kevin R. Filiatraut, Assistant County Prosecutor, The Justice Center, 8th Floor, 1200 Ontario Street, Cleveland, OH 44113, Attorneys for Appellee.

Before: Stewart, J., Cooney, P.J., and Boyle, J.


JOURNAL ENTRY AND OPINION

MELODY J. STEWART, J.:

{¶ 1} Defendant-appellant Richard Selman appeals from his conviction on one count of domestic violence.
